## Deployment

LedgerBranch handles currency conversion for all Fennwick Pay storefronts, and rounding behavior is deployment-critical. A mismatch between the rounding mode in the conversion service and the one assumed by downstream reconciliation jobs will produce off-by-one-cent drift that compounds across thousands of orders. Always deploy LedgerBranch and the reconciler in the same window, and verify the banker's-rounding flag is identical in both. Before promoting a build, confirm the environment carries exactly the following settings.

deployment values, faduf-tawep:
SORDOR_LOG_LEVEL=error
SORDOR_METRICS_HOST=metrics.sordor.nelvrolabs.internal
SORDOR_POOL_SIZE=4

Subject: New "Lumenfold Plus" tier — quick heads-up

Team,

We're ready to pitch the Lumenfold Plus subscription tier at Thursday's board session. Pricing lands between Core and Atlas, with usage caps that should nudge upgrades without annoying anyone. Marra's team has the deck nearly final. Details on the rollout strategy are appended below for board eyes only.

internal memo for kawip-hadug: Headcount on the Wenwyn team goes from 7 to 140 by the end of January. Gross margin on Wenwyn came in at 20 percent against a plan of 15 percent.

- [ ] Step 7: Archive cold storage buckets (Glacierline tier). Confirm both ceremony witnesses are present, verify bucket manifests match the Oxbow ledger, then seal the archive key shares. Plugin authors may observe but not handle shares. Once sealed, the archive index itself is encrypted and can only be reopened with the passphrase below.

vault phrase of badup-hahig = tamael-aldael-kelmir-istael-fenok-istwyn-tamius-jorath-oliion

# Lattice Components — Versioning Env Vars

The Bramblehook shared component library uses LIB_VERSION_CHANNEL (stable, beta, canary) to pick a release stream. Pin LIB_VERSION_PIN to an exact semver when reproducing bugs; leave it unset otherwise. CI reads both at build time and refuses mismatched channels. Bump the channel only after the Tuesday release train clears. Publishing to the internal registry requires an auth token; the variable below holds it.

sealed setting: ARCHIVE_KEY3=8d0